1What are common plumbing issues for Calera homeowners related to our local climate and soil?

Calera's clay-rich soil is prone to expansion and contraction with seasonal wet/dry cycles, which can stress and shift underground sewer lines, leading to cracks, blockages, or misaligned pipes. Additionally, while freezing is less common, the occasional hard freeze can still cause pipes in uninsulated crawl spaces or exterior walls to burst. Proactive inspections and proper exterior pipe insulation are key local preventative measures.

2How do I verify a plumbing contractor is properly licensed and insured to work in Calera, Alabama?

Always ask to see their current Alabama State Plumbing Board license; you can verify it online through the Board's licensee lookup tool. For work within Calera city limits, also confirm they hold a City of Calera business license. Reputable plumbers will readily provide proof of both general liability and worker's compensation insurance to protect your home and their employees on your property.

3Are there specific times of year when I should schedule preventative plumbing maintenance in Calera?

Yes, late fall is ideal for preparing for potential freezes by insulating pipes and draining outdoor spigots. Early spring, after the rainy season, is a good time to check for leaks and assess drainage, as saturated clay soil can reveal foundation or sewer line issues. Scheduling non-emergency services during these shoulder seasons can also be easier than during peak summer or winter demand.

4What is a typical price range for common plumbing repairs like water heater replacement or sewer line clearing in Calera?

Costs vary by project scope and materials, but local averages provide a guide. A standard 50-gallon gas water heater replacement typically ranges from $1,200 to $2,500 installed. For sewer line clearing with a hydro-jetter, expect $300 to $600, but a full sewer line repair or replacement due to clay soil damage can cost $4,000 to $15,000+. Always get a detailed, written estimate before work begins.

5My house is on a septic system. Are there local regulations or best practices I should know about for plumbing maintenance?

Yes, Shelby County (where Calera is located) has specific health department regulations governing septic system installation, repair, and pumping. It's crucial to have your tank pumped and inspected every 3-5 years, depending on household size. Avoid flushing anything besides toilet paper and be mindful of water usage, as excessive flow can overload the drain field, especially during our frequent heavy rain periods.
